YUPO demo by artist Sandy Sandy at Dick Blick

 

For all you Manhattanites, join us this Thursday, August 22nd from 2-4pm at the NEW Dick Blick Store in Chelsea to experience first-hand why YUPO synthetic paper has become the hottest surface to paint on. 

Artist Sandy Sandy takes you through some of her tips, tricks and techniques used to create her watercolor masterpieces.

Since 1996, Sandy has been a professional fine artist and up to January of 2009, has devoted her career to painting full time. A strong connection with animals and nature has been evident over the past years and through thousands of paintings. Her philosophy of spirit, who she is, and who she strives to become, is woven into her work. Having studied watercolor with many nationally known watercolor masters including those from the E.A.Whitney, Brandywine and New Hope Schools has given Sandy roots that are strong in the American Art Tradition.

Utrecht's Grand Re-Opening of Chelsea Store in NYC

 

The grand re-opening of the latest Utrecht store in Manhattan (Chelsea on 23rd street between 7th and 8th Ave) occurred over the weekend and we were on site to check things out.  The redesign is truly beautiful.  Everything is laid out well and is easy to find.

The paper pad section of the store takes up an entire aisle, while the full sheeted papers are cleanly stowed away in flat files that take up an entire wall.  Pretty impressive.
